Foros del Web » Soporte técnico » Ofimática »

Desprotejer una hoja o libro de excel con contraseña

Estas en el tema de Desprotejer una hoja o libro de excel con contraseña en el foro de Ofimática en Foros del Web. Buenas noches, un favor enorme, me podrian decir como desprotejer una hoja o libro de excel que tiene contraseña. Gracias...
  #1 (permalink)  
Antiguo 16/12/2006, 21:42
 
Fecha de Ingreso: julio-2005
Mensajes: 21
Antigüedad: 18 años, 9 meses
Puntos: 0
Desprotejer una hoja o libro de excel con contraseña

Buenas noches, un favor enorme, me podrian decir como desprotejer una hoja o libro de excel que tiene contraseña. Gracias
  #2 (permalink)  
Antiguo 17/12/2006, 14:53
Avatar de GERTU  
Fecha de Ingreso: noviembre-2006
Mensajes: 85
Antigüedad: 17 años, 5 meses
Puntos: 1
Re: Desprotejer una hoja o libro de excel con contraseña

Existen programas específicos para ese tipo de tareas. De todas maneras, no creo que sea muy legal eso de andar quitando la contraseña a un documento. Se supone que el autor ha puesto esa restricción al documento precisamente porque no quería que cualquiera accediera a la información.

Última edición por GERTU; 18/12/2006 a las 17:15
  #3 (permalink)  
Antiguo 18/12/2006, 13:36
Avatar de Linterns
Colaborador
 
Fecha de Ingreso: diciembre-2001
Mensajes: 2.799
Antigüedad: 22 años, 4 meses
Puntos: 11
Re: Desprotejer una hoja o libro de excel con contraseña

Presiona ALT + F8 para que te da la pantallita de crear una macro y escribe un nombre determinado y presiona la tecla CREAR

esto te llevara al editor de VB y sutituye lo tecleado por lo siguiente
Código:
Sub breakit()

   Dim i As Integer, j As Integer, k As Integer
   Dim l As Integer, m As Integer, n As Integer
   On Error Resume Next
     For i = 65 To 66
      For j = 65 To 66
       For k = 65 To 66
        For l = 65 To 66
         For m = 65 To 66
          For i1 = 65 To 66
           For i2 = 65 To 66
            For i3 = 65 To 66
             For i4 = 65 To 66
              For i5 = 65 To 66
               For i6 = 65 To 66
                For n = 32 To 126
   ActiveSheet.Unprotect Chr(i) & Chr(j) & Chr(k) & _ 
      Chr(l) & Chr(m) & Chr(i1) & Chr(i2) & Chr(i3) & _
      Chr(i4) & Chr(i5) & Chr(i6) & Chr(n)
   If ActiveSheet.ProtectContents = False Then
      MsgBox "One usable password is " & Chr(i) & Chr(j) & _
         Chr(k) & Chr(l) & Chr(m) & Chr(i1) & Chr(i2) & Chr(i3) _
         & Chr(i4) & Chr(i5) & Chr(i6) & Chr(n)
      Exit Sub
   End If
               Next
              Next
             Next
            Next
           Next
          Next
         Next
        Next
       Next
      Next
     Next
    Next

End Sub
Guarda y luego ejecuta dicha macro.... espera unos cuantos minutos y te mostrara una advertencia con la clave Interna de Excel y te desbloqueara la hoja de la cual deseas ver las formulas.
__________________
Bien se puede recibir una puñalada sin adulación,
pero rara vez se recibe una adulación sin puñalada
** ***
  #4 (permalink)  
Antiguo 21/12/2006, 22:15
 
Fecha de Ingreso: julio-2005
Mensajes: 21
Antigüedad: 18 años, 9 meses
Puntos: 0
Re: Desprotejer una hoja o libro de excel con contraseña

Cita:
Iniciado por Linterns Ver Mensaje
Presiona ALT + F8 para que te da la pantallita de crear una macro y escribe un nombre determinado y presiona la tecla CREAR

esto te llevara al editor de VB y sutituye lo tecleado por lo siguiente
Código:
Sub breakit()

   Dim i As Integer, j As Integer, k As Integer
   Dim l As Integer, m As Integer, n As Integer
   On Error Resume Next
     For i = 65 To 66
      For j = 65 To 66
       For k = 65 To 66
        For l = 65 To 66
         For m = 65 To 66
          For i1 = 65 To 66
           For i2 = 65 To 66
            For i3 = 65 To 66
             For i4 = 65 To 66
              For i5 = 65 To 66
               For i6 = 65 To 66
                For n = 32 To 126
   ActiveSheet.Unprotect Chr(i) & Chr(j) & Chr(k) & _ 
      Chr(l) & Chr(m) & Chr(i1) & Chr(i2) & Chr(i3) & _
      Chr(i4) & Chr(i5) & Chr(i6) & Chr(n)
   If ActiveSheet.ProtectContents = False Then
      MsgBox "One usable password is " & Chr(i) & Chr(j) & _
         Chr(k) & Chr(l) & Chr(m) & Chr(i1) & Chr(i2) & Chr(i3) _
         & Chr(i4) & Chr(i5) & Chr(i6) & Chr(n)
      Exit Sub
   End If
               Next
              Next
             Next
            Next
           Next
          Next
         Next
        Next
       Next
      Next
     Next
    Next

End Sub
Guarda y luego ejecuta dicha macro.... espera unos cuantos minutos y te mostrara una advertencia con la clave Interna de Excel y te desbloqueara la hoja de la cual deseas ver las formulas.
  #5 (permalink)  
Antiguo 21/12/2006, 22:16
 
Fecha de Ingreso: julio-2005
Mensajes: 21
Antigüedad: 18 años, 9 meses
Puntos: 0
Re: Desprotejer una hoja o libro de excel con contraseña

Gracias, si funciono la macro que me pasaste para desprotejer la hoja, mil gracias
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Tema Cerrado




La zona horaria es GMT -6. Ahora son las 20:29.